--- In TekScopes@..., "David C. Partridge" <david.partridge@...> wrote:

In equivalent time, sequential mode, the trace is shifting left as I rotate the time/div knob.

All measurements were made on the 50nS sweep range with the timebase triggered from Pulse Out.

Looking at the signal at TP286 which is the output of the TTH circuit, I see:

Time/Div Start V Stop V Delta V
5nS -2.22V -7.82V -5.6V
2nS -2.22V -4.62V -2.3V
1nS -2.22V -3.5V -1.2V
.5nS -2.22V -2.76V -560mV
.2nS -2.22V -2.43mV -230mV
.1nS -2.22V -2.34mV -120mV
50pS -2.22V -2.62mV -60mV (approx values)
20pS -2.22V -2.25V -30mV
10pS -2.22V -2.23V -10mV

Looking at the output of U512A (TP512):

Time/Div Start V Stop V Delta V
5nS -0.1V +5.5V 5.6V
2nS -0.3V +5.3V 5.6V
1nS -0.6V +5.0V 5.6V
.5nS -900mV +470mV 560mV
.2nS -210mV +350mV 560mV
.1nS -420mV +140mV 560mV
50pS -70mV -10mV 60mV (approx values)
20pS -170mV -110mV 60mV
10pS -340mV -280mV 60mV

I don't think the ramp start voltage should be moving down like that.

Can anyone confirm my suspicions and suggest what the fault might be?
